Bowling in Pull Shot Legend India is equally detailed and authentic to Indian cricket, with a focus on the diverse bowling styles that are a hallmark of Indian domestic cricket. The game features four main bowling categories, each with authentic variations that reflect the Indian cricket landscape and are balanced to provide a challenging yet rewarding experience for players who prefer bowling:

  1. Fast Bowling 🔥: Fast bowling in Pull Shot Legend India includes variations like yorkers, bouncers, slower balls, and cutters – styles popularized by Indian fast bowlers like Jasprit Bumrah, Mohammed Shami, and Ishant Sharma. The fast bowling mechanics are designed to reflect the challenges of bowling in Indian conditions, with pace being less important than line, length, and variation – a key insight from the game's research with Indian fast bowlers.
  2. Spin Bowling 🌀: Spin bowling is given pride of place in Pull Shot Legend India, reflecting its importance in Indian cricket. The game features leg spin, off spin, left-arm orthodox, and chinaman bowling, each with multiple variations (flight, drift, turn, and pace changes) that mimic the styles of Indian spin legends like Anil Kumble, Ravichandran Ashwin, and Harbhajan Singh. Spin bowling in Pull Shot Legend India is particularly effective on turning pitches, with the game accurately simulating how the ball grips and turns on different Indian wickets.
  3. Medium Pace 🥌: Medium pace bowling in Pull Shot Legend India represents the workhorse bowlers of Indian domestic cricket, who rely on swing, seam, and accuracy rather than raw pace. This bowling type is particularly effective in the middle overs of limited-overs matches and is a staple of Ranji Trophy gameplay in Pull Shot Legend India, reflecting the reality of Indian domestic cricket where medium pacers play a crucial role.
  4. Death Bowling 💥: A specialized bowling mode in Pull Shot Legend India focused on the challenging final overs of T20 and ODI matches – a skill mastered by Indian bowlers like Jasprit Bumrah and Bhuvneshwar Kumar. Death bowling mechanics include precision yorkers, slower balls, and strategic field placements, with the game rewarding bowlers who can execute consistent death overs under pressure – a key aspect of successful limited-overs cricket in India.

The bowling interface in Pull Shot Legend India uses a target system where players aim at specific areas of the crease, with a power meter that determines delivery speed and a variation meter that adds subtle changes to the ball's trajectory – a unique feature that adds depth to the bowling experience. What sets Pull Shot Legend India apart from other cricket games is its "Indian Bowling Intelligence" – an AI system that mimics the strategic approach of Indian bowlers, who are known for their ability to outthink batsmen rather than just outpace them.

In Pull Shot Legend India, successful bowling is not just about raw skill but also about strategy and adaptation – much like in real Indian cricket. Bowlers must read the batsman's tendencies, adjust to pitch conditions, and vary their deliveries to induce mistakes. This strategic depth makes bowling in Pull Shot Legend India as engaging and rewarding as batting, a balance that few cricket games achieve and one that has contributed significantly to the game's broad appeal in India.

T20 Bowling Strategy in Pull Shot Legend India

T20 is the most popular format in Pull Shot Legend India, and successful bowling in this format requires a mix of aggression and containment. Top players focus on line and length rather than raw pace, using variations to keep batsmen guessing and restrict scoring opportunities. The powerplay overs (first 6 overs) are crucial in T20 cricket, and elite Pull Shot Legend India players use yorkers and slower balls to prevent boundary hits, setting a defensive field with two fielders outside the circle. In the middle overs (7-15), spin bowlers become more effective on Indian pitches, with top players using the "spin trap" strategy – setting a field with close-in catchers and bowling consecutive spin deliveries to induce mistakes from aggressive batsmen. The death overs (16-20) require precision execution of yorkers and bouncers, with the slower ball as a surprise weapon to disrupt the batsman's timing – a strategy perfected by Indian death bowling specialists like Jasprit Bumrah and used extensively in Pull Shot Legend India's competitive scene.
